As nouns, macrocyte is a hyponym of RBC; that is, macrocyte is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than RBC:
  • RBC: a mature blood cell that contains hemoglobin to carry oxygen to the bodily tissues; a biconcave disc that has no nucleus
  • macrocyte: abnormally large red blood cell (associated with pernicious anemia)
